In Shatti Al Qurum, Mandarin Oriental, Muscat sits between the Gulf of Oman and the mountains that give the capital its dramatic horizon. Natural tones, local craft references and broad windows define the rooms and suites, framing sea, city or Hajar Mountain views. Dining and lounge spaces are arranged around coastal light and Omani warmth, supported by pools, spa facilities and a measured beachfront rhythm. The hotel's position places beaches, embassies and cultural venues nearby, with Muttrah's corniche, souq and historic waterfront giving a deeper sense of Muscat beyond the resort.
